The nitty-gritty on Joanna Gaines' go-to accent. Tailored shiplap walls made of paint-grade … WebYou cannot nail planks directly to studs without a fire barrier. This is building and fire code and homeowners insurance regulations. You need to screw at least 1/2" drywall to the studs which acts as a fire barrier. Then you can cover with anything you choose. WebOct 7, 2024 · If you do not want to drill into the cinder block wall you could make a frame studded wall against it and attach it to the cinder block securely and then attach your shiplap. The frame would not have to be as thick as a normal 2x4 studded wall unless you are planning to add a lot of weight to the wall.
